Sept 14 (Reuters) – The Russian strike on a train near the Ukraine-Poland border carried out with the aim to intimidate and divide Europeans, French foreign ministers Jean-Noel Barrot said at the European Arctic Summit in Finland on Monday.
A Russian drone hit a passenger train on Ukraine’s border with NATO member Poland on Sunday, shortly after the presence of a diplomatic train with former British Prime Minister Boris Johnson and other European diplomats on board.
